Sussex County Economic Development Partnership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 120,848 | 95,431 | 25,417 | 11.0 | — |
| 2012 | 68,291 | 87,248 | −18,957 | 8.1 | — |
| 2013 | 59,560 | 64,230 | −4,670 | 10.1 | — |
| 2014 | 81,285 | 87,690 | −6,405 | 6.5 | — |
| 2015 | 101,839 | 110,341 | −8,502 | 4.2 | — |
| 2016 | 50,643 | 66,100 | −15,457 | 4.3 | — |
| 2017 | 67,254 | 89,458 | −22,204 | 0.2 | — |
| 2018 | 71,283 | 63,627 | 7,656 | 1.7 | — |
| 2019 | 65,198 | 56,502 | 8,696 | 3.7 | — |
| 2020 | 50,577 | 60,668 | −10,091 | 1.5 | — |
| 2021 | 59,592 | 57,013 | 2,579 | 2.1 | — |
| 2022 | 84,624 | 60,807 | 23,817 | 6.7 | — |
| 2023 | 65,915 | 57,945 | 7,970 | 8.7 | — |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$7,970 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 8.7 months of spending, down from 11 in 2011.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ash.
